South Surrey Support Service offers support to people across two sites in Redhill and Horley, supporting people to live independently in their own homes.

In Horley, we offer accessible accommodation for people with learning disabilities and autism across two homes, complete with wet rooms and hoists to cater for a variety of needs.

In Redhill, our supported living accommodation extends across the Royal Hill Park development, set alongside other private homes. The supported living homes are a variety of newly built apartments and shared houses, with easy access to both the Redhill town centre and the nature of the North Downs.

SeeAbility is unique in providing in-house specialist support, including vision rehabilitation and, where commissioned, positive behaviour support (PBS).

Our focus is on encouraging people to challenge themselves to achieve their own goals and get the most out of life, while supporting increased independence and choice. Our support teams are also trained in Active Support, which encourages people we're supporting to take control of their lives.
